Consola de AWS

From binaryoption
Jump to navigation Jump to search
Баннер1
  1. Consola de AWS: Una Guía Completa para Principiantes

La Consola de AWS es la interfaz web centralizada que Amazon Web Services (AWS) ofrece para administrar sus diversos servicios en la nube. Para cualquier persona que se inicie en el mundo de AWS, comprender la Consola es fundamental. Este artículo proporciona una guía detallada, paso a paso, para principiantes, cubriendo su estructura, navegación, funcionalidades clave y cómo aprovecharla al máximo. Aunque el enfoque principal es la Consola, exploraremos también cómo se relaciona con otras herramientas de AWS y su importancia en el contexto más amplio de la computación en la nube. Este conocimiento, aunque aparentemente ajeno al mundo de las opciones binarias, es vital para cualquier trader que busque automatizar sus estrategias o alojar sus propios sistemas de trading en una infraestructura robusta y escalable.

¿Qué es AWS y por qué usar la Consola?

AWS es el proveedor de servicios en la nube más grande del mundo, ofreciendo una amplia gama de servicios que incluyen computación, almacenamiento, bases de datos, análisis, aprendizaje automático, inteligencia artificial, y mucho más. En lugar de comprar y mantener su propia infraestructura de TI, las empresas y los individuos pueden alquilar estos servicios de AWS bajo un modelo de pago por uso.

La Consola de AWS actúa como un panel de control para todos estos servicios. Permite a los usuarios:

  • **Gestionar recursos:** Crear, configurar y eliminar instancias de computación (como EC2), bases de datos (como RDS), almacenamiento (como S3) y otros recursos.
  • **Monitorear el rendimiento:** Seguir el uso de recursos, identificar cuellos de botella y optimizar el rendimiento.
  • **Configurar la seguridad:** Controlar el acceso a los recursos y proteger los datos.
  • **Automatizar tareas:** Utilizar herramientas como CloudFormation para definir y aprovisionar infraestructura como código.
  • **Gestionar costes:** Supervisar el gasto y optimizar los costes de los servicios de AWS.

En el contexto de las opciones binarias, la Consola de AWS puede ser utilizada para:

  • **Alojar Bots de Trading:** Implementar y ejecutar algoritmos de trading automatizados (bots) en instancias de EC2.
  • **Almacenar Datos Históricos:** Almacenar grandes cantidades de datos históricos de precios en S3 para análisis y backtesting de estrategias.
  • **Crear APIs Personalizadas:** Desarrollar APIs personalizadas usando API Gateway y Lambda para conectar brokers de opciones binarias con sus sistemas de trading.
  • **Análisis de Datos en Tiempo Real:** Utilizar servicios como Kinesis para procesar flujos de datos de precios en tiempo real y tomar decisiones de trading basadas en esos datos.

Estructura y Navegación de la Consola

La Consola de AWS tiene una estructura jerárquica. Al iniciar sesión, se presenta la página de inicio, que ofrece un acceso rápido a los servicios utilizados recientemente y a los recursos recomendados. La estructura principal se compone de:

  • **Regiones:** AWS tiene regiones geográficas alrededor del mundo (por ejemplo, EE. UU. Este (Norte de Virginia), Europa (Irlanda), Asia Pacífico (Tokio)). Es crucial seleccionar la región correcta porque afecta la latencia, los costes y la disponibilidad de los servicios. La elección de la región impacta directamente en la velocidad de ejecución de los bots de trading y el acceso a los datos.
  • **Servicios:** La Consola agrupa los servicios de AWS en categorías como Computación, Almacenamiento, Bases de Datos, Análisis, etc. Dentro de cada categoría, encontrará servicios específicos. Por ejemplo, en Computación, encontrará EC2, Lambda, Elastic Beanstalk.
  • **Paneles:** Muchos servicios tienen paneles que proporcionan una visión general del estado y la configuración de los recursos.
  • **Búsqueda:** La barra de búsqueda en la parte superior de la Consola le permite encontrar rápidamente servicios, recursos o funcionalidades específicas.

La navegación es relativamente intuitiva. Puede acceder a un servicio específico:

1. **A través del menú de servicios:** Haga clic en el icono de menú (tres líneas horizontales) en la esquina superior izquierda para abrir el menú de servicios. Puede navegar por categorías o utilizar la barra de búsqueda. 2. **A través de la página de inicio:** Si ha utilizado un servicio recientemente, aparecerá en la sección "Servicios recientes" de la página de inicio. 3. **A través de URL directas:** Cada servicio tiene una URL directa que puede guardar como marcador.

Funcionalidades Clave de la Consola

La Consola de AWS ofrece una amplia gama de funcionalidades. Aquí hay algunas de las más importantes:

  • **IAM (Identity and Access Management):** Es fundamental para la seguridad. Permite crear usuarios y grupos, asignar permisos y controlar el acceso a los recursos de AWS. En el contexto de las opciones binarias, IAM es vital para proteger las claves de acceso a sus APIs y asegurar que solo las personas autorizadas puedan acceder a sus datos de trading.
  • **EC2 (Elastic Compute Cloud):** Proporciona instancias de computación virtual en la nube. Puede elegir entre una variedad de tipos de instancias, sistemas operativos y configuraciones. Utilizado para alojar bots de trading y aplicaciones de análisis.
  • **S3 (Simple Storage Service):** Ofrece almacenamiento de objetos escalable y duradero. Ideal para almacenar datos históricos de precios, registros de trading y otros archivos.
  • **RDS (Relational Database Service):** Facilita la configuración y administración de bases de datos relacionales como MySQL, PostgreSQL, Oracle y SQL Server. Puede usar RDS para almacenar datos de trading estructurados.
  • **Lambda:** Permite ejecutar código sin aprovisionar ni administrar servidores. Utilizado para crear funciones serverless que pueden ser desencadenadas por eventos, como cambios en los precios de las opciones binarias.
  • **CloudWatch:** Proporciona monitoreo y registro de los recursos de AWS. Puede usar CloudWatch para supervisar el rendimiento de sus bots de trading, detectar errores y configurar alarmas.
  • **CloudFormation:** Permite definir y aprovisionar infraestructura como código. Utilizado para automatizar la creación y configuración de su entorno de trading en AWS.
  • **Cost Explorer:** Ayuda a analizar y optimizar los costes de los servicios de AWS.

Utilizando la Consola para Tareas Comunes

Para ilustrar cómo usar la Consola de AWS, veamos algunos ejemplos de tareas comunes:

  • **Crear una Instancia EC2:**
   1.  Vaya al servicio EC2.
   2.  Haga clic en "Launch Instance".
   3.  Seleccione una AMI (Amazon Machine Image) que contenga el sistema operativo deseado.
   4.  Elija un tipo de instancia que se adapte a sus necesidades.
   5.  Configure los detalles de la instancia, como el grupo de seguridad y la clave de par.
   6.  Lance la instancia.
  • **Crear un Bucket S3:**
   1.  Vaya al servicio S3.
   2.  Haga clic en "Create bucket".
   3.  Especifique un nombre de bucket único.
   4.  Seleccione una región.
   5.  Configure las opciones de control de versiones y cifrado.
   6.  Cree el bucket.
  • **Crear una Función Lambda:**
   1.  Vaya al servicio Lambda.
   2.  Haga clic en "Create function".
   3.  Seleccione "Author from scratch".
   4.  Especifique un nombre de función.
   5.  Elija un tiempo de ejecución (por ejemplo, Python 3.9).
   6.  Configure las opciones de memoria y tiempo de espera.
   7.  Cree la función.

Seguridad en la Consola de AWS

La seguridad es una preocupación fundamental al utilizar AWS. Aquí hay algunas prácticas recomendadas:

  • **Habilitar la autenticación multifactor (MFA):** Añade una capa adicional de seguridad a su cuenta de AWS.
  • **Utilizar IAM para controlar el acceso:** Asigne los permisos mínimos necesarios a cada usuario y grupo.
  • **Cifrar los datos:** Utilice el cifrado en reposo y en tránsito para proteger sus datos.
  • **Monitorear la actividad de la cuenta:** Utilice CloudTrail para registrar todas las llamadas a la API de AWS y detectar actividades sospechosas.
  • **Mantener el software actualizado:** Actualice regularmente el software de sus instancias EC2 y otros recursos.

Herramientas Adicionales para Gestionar AWS

Si bien la Consola de AWS es la interfaz principal, existen otras herramientas que pueden complementar su uso:

  • **AWS CLI (Command Line Interface):** Permite gestionar los recursos de AWS desde la línea de comandos. Útil para automatizar tareas y crear scripts.
  • **AWS SDKs (Software Development Kits):** Proporcionan APIs para interactuar con los servicios de AWS desde diferentes lenguajes de programación. Esencial para desarrollar aplicaciones que utilicen AWS.
  • **Terraform:** Una herramienta de infraestructura como código que permite definir y aprovisionar recursos de AWS (y otros proveedores de nube) de forma declarativa.
  • **Ansible:** Una herramienta de automatización de TI que puede utilizarse para configurar y administrar recursos de AWS.

Integración con Estrategias de Trading y Análisis Técnico

La Consola de AWS permite la integración con diversas herramientas y estrategias utilizadas en el trading de opciones binarias y análisis técnico:

  • **Backtesting:** Utilizar S3 para almacenar datos históricos y EC2 para ejecutar scripts de backtesting de estrategias.
  • **Análisis de Volumen:** Procesar grandes volúmenes de datos de precios utilizando Kinesis y EC2 para identificar patrones y tendencias. Análisis de Volumen
  • **Indicadores Técnicos:** Implementar algoritmos para calcular indicadores técnicos (como medias móviles, RSI, MACD) en Lambda y utilizar los resultados para generar señales de trading. Medias Móviles , RSI (Relative Strength Index) , MACD (Moving Average Convergence Divergence)
  • **Estrategias de Martingala:** Alojar bots que implementen estrategias de Martingala en EC2. Estrategia de Martingala (considerar los riesgos asociados)
  • **Estrategias de Hedging:** Utilizar Lambda para automatizar estrategias de hedging basadas en los precios de las opciones binarias.
  • **Arbitraje:** Desarrollar sistemas de arbitraje que identifiquen diferencias de precios entre diferentes brokers utilizando Lambda y API Gateway.
  • **Análisis de Sentimiento:** Utilizar servicios de análisis de texto de AWS para analizar noticias y redes sociales y determinar el sentimiento del mercado. Análisis de Sentimiento
  • **Machine Learning para Predicción:** Utilizar SageMaker para entrenar modelos de aprendizaje automático que predigan los movimientos de precios de las opciones binarias. Aprendizaje Automático
  • **Estrategias basadas en Patrones de Velas:** Implementar algoritmos para identificar patrones de velas japonesas en Lambda y generar señales de trading. Patrones de Velas Japonesas
  • **Estrategias de Ruptura (Breakout):** Utilizar Kinesis para detectar rupturas de niveles de soporte y resistencia en tiempo real. Estrategias de Ruptura
  • **Estrategias de Retroceso (Pullback):** Detectar retrocesos en tendencias utilizando análisis de volumen y EC2 para ejecutar operaciones. Estrategias de Retroceso
  • **Análisis de Ondas de Elliott:** Implementar algoritmos para identificar ondas de Elliott en los gráficos de precios. Análisis de Ondas de Elliott
  • **Fibonacci Retracements:** Utilizar Lambda para calcular niveles de Fibonacci y generar señales de trading. Fibonacci Retracements
  • **Ichimoku Cloud:** Implementar algoritmos para analizar la nube Ichimoku y generar señales de trading. Ichimoku Cloud
  • **Análisis de Correlación:** Analizar la correlación entre diferentes activos utilizando datos almacenados en S3 y EC2. Análisis de Correlación

Conclusión

La Consola de AWS es una herramienta poderosa y versátil que puede ser utilizada para una amplia gama de tareas, desde la gestión de infraestructura en la nube hasta la automatización de estrategias de trading de opciones binarias. Comprender su estructura, navegación y funcionalidades clave es fundamental para cualquier persona que quiera aprovechar al máximo los servicios de AWS. Recuerde priorizar la seguridad y utilizar las herramientas adicionales disponibles para optimizar su flujo de trabajo y automatizar tareas. La inversión de tiempo en el aprendizaje de la Consola de AWS puede resultar en una mayor eficiencia, escalabilidad y rentabilidad en sus esfuerzos de trading.

Comienza a operar ahora

Regístrate en IQ Option (depósito mínimo $10) Abre una cuenta en Pocket Option (depósito mínimo $5)

Únete a nuestra comunidad

Suscríbete a nuestro canal de Telegram @strategybin y obtén: ✓ Señales de trading diarias ✓ Análisis estratégicos exclusivos ✓ Alertas sobre tendencias del mercado ✓ Materiales educativos para principiantes

Баннер